In October 2023 I got the opportunity to visit Mykonos on a day trip from my Princess Cruise Fam trip. Mykonos is one of the most popular and famous islands in Greece, known for its stunning beauty, vibrant nightlife, and charming Cycladic architecture.

• The best time to visit Mykonos is from May to October, when the weather is warm and sunny, and the island is bustling with activity. • July and August are the peak tourist months, so if you prefer a quieter experience, it’s better to visit in May, June, or September.

Some of the best sights on the island which are worth visiting on the island are Mykonos Town itself. It was lovely to roam through the winding streets to see the whitewashed buildings. The town had a fabulous atmosphere as you explored the labyrinth of narrow cobblestone streets while browsing the quaint tourist shops.

Little Venice features buildings with balconies that extend over the water and provide the perfect backdrop for sunset views. It’s one of the most picturesque spots on the island. There were some lovely restaurants and cafes along this are where you could enjoy a meal or drink to sit and people watch with beautiful sea views. From here I went onto explore the windmills of Mykonos. These are perched on a hill above Mykonos town. The views from here were also breath taking.
